Throat mucus from Zyn? by Klutzy_Investment_72 in QuittingZyn

[–]Cbbigmartha 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Just seeing this, went to the doc and they stuck a camera down my nose and all that; ended up being silent reflux cause nicotine naturally relaxes your sphincter causing reflux. Zyn even more so given it has the most direct impact to your stomach vs vaping and other forms. I haven’t fully quit but only probably go through a can or two a week (used to go through one a day) and was started on famotidine for 8 weeks. Gotten significantly better but still creeps back every now and then but I’d take this all day.

Need help navigating league punishment by Melodic-Volume5161 in FFCommish

[–]Cbbigmartha 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Punishments are intended to deter lackadaisical managers that abandon teams mid year. Not to completely ruin their life for a few days. My league had this issue where every year the punishment had to “one up” the previous year, it got to a point where it was toeing the line of the law, involving people unrelated to our league, or affecting the jobs/work of our league mates. Eventually someone lost who was in a government agency physically couldn’t do the punishment and some wanted to kick the guy out. We realized how dumb some of it was and went back to simple stupid stuff, eating challenges have been the norm since. Easy, kinda sucks but whatever, and end of the day funny. Punishments got to a point where you just want to ruin the persons bloodline lol

Things you added to your home league that improved your league by vinnymacaroni in FFCommish

[–]Cbbigmartha -1 points0 points  (0 children)

One thing I did that was a huge hit was kicker fractional points. Example a 45 yarder was 4.5 points instead of 4. I felt the difference of a 40 and 49 yarder was enough to get something out of it. Thus getting 0.9 extra points. Every kick a kicker makes goes on their stat sheet so why not for fantasy? It has been a great change and only give kickers more points

[deleted by user] by [deleted] in GolfSwing

[–]Cbbigmartha 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Keep lead foot planted, lead knee (mostly) in line with lead foot. Don’t jump through your swing, at the top of your swing give it a .3 second pause, let your hands drop and let your hips do the work turning through the ball, wrists ahead of the ball at club/ball impact. And like other guy said. Slow. Down. You will throw your back out so fast with a swing like that.
